The something Old Vintage Wedding Fair: We're back for a second installment of 'Something Old' this February, conveniently located around Valentines!
Join us for a bigger and better exhibition of all things vintage wedding in the stunning Town Hall
40 vintage wedding specialists will be setting up on the day alongside fabulous vintage acts who will be performing for your entertainment
With local exhibitors and vintage wedding experts from all over the UK, this fair offers everything for those who are planning a unique vintage wedding day.
Exhibitors will include crockery hire, vintage & vintage inspired dresses for Brides and wedding party, beautiful accessories and jewellery, stationary, floral arrangements and alternative bouquets, cakes & cupcakes and even a vintage stylist specialising in hair, make up and hen parties.
Advice, entertainment & demonstrations also provided on the day.

The something Old Vintage Wedding Fair at Sheffield Town Hall in Sheffield, Yorkshire on Saturday, 11 February 2012.
